Fluid—a substance made up of particles that can move freely about; it
can be a liquid or a gas.
Formation—rocks or strata that are recognized and mapped as a unit.
Fracture—the kind of surface obtained if a mineral is broken in a
different direction from that of the cleavage or parting. Commonly,
fracture surfaces are rough, uneven, or curved, whereas cleavage
surfaces are smooth.
Geologic map (areal)—shows the extent and distribution of formations
exposed at the earth’s surface.
Granular—the texture of a rock or mineral that is made up of visible
grains. If all the grains are about the same size, the term
_equigranular_ is used.
Granule—a rock or mineral fragment that has a diameter of from 2 to 4
millimeters (about ⁸/₁₀₀ to ¹⁵/₁₀₀ of an inch).
Gravel—uncemented rock or mineral fragments that have diameters greater
than 2 millimeters (about ⁸/₁₀₀ of an inch).
Gulf Coastal Plain—an area that extends, in Texas, from the Gulf of
Mexico to the Balcones fault zone and in which Quaternary, Tertiary, and
Upper Cretaceous strata crop out at the surface (_see_ p. 42).
High Plains—an area in northwest Texas extending from the Pecos River
valley north to the Oklahoma-Texas boundary (_see_ p. 42).
Igneous rocks—rocks formed by the cooling and hardening of hot, molten
rock material.
Intrusive rocks—igneous rocks that have formed below the surface of the
earth.
Lava—molten rock material that has poured out onto the earth’s surface
from volcanoes; also the rock that is formed after the molten material
has cooled and hardened.
Llano uplift—an area in central Texas where Precambrian and early
Paleozoic rocks occur at the earth’s surface (_see_ p. 42).
Magma—hot, molten rock material from which igneous rocks form.
Massive—in a mass, without a regular or complete form.
Mesozoic—an era, one of the great divisions of geologic time (_see_ p.
3). This era began about 230 million years ago and lasted until about 63
million years ago.
Metamorphic rock—rock formed from igneous or sedimentary rocks that are
altered by heat, pressure, and fluids below the earth’s surface.
Miocene—the fourth epoch of the Tertiary Period (_see_ p. 3).
Mississippian—the fifth period of the Paleozoic Era (_see_ p. 3).
Nodule—a small, rounded mass or lump.
Octahedron—a solid that has eight triangular faces.
Opaque—no light can pass through.
Ordovician—the second period of the Paleozoic Era (_see_ p. 3).
Paleozoic—an era, one of the great divisions of geologic time (_see_ p.
3). This era began at the end of Precambrian time and lasted until about
230 million years ago.
Parting—occurs when a mineral breaks along a flat surface that is not a
true cleavage plane.
Pebble—a rock or mineral fragment that has a diameter between 4 and 64
millimeters (about ¹⁵/₁₀₀ and 2½ inches).
Pennsylvanian—the sixth period of the Paleozoic Era (_see_ p. 3).
Period—a unit of geologic time, a subdivision of an era.
Permian—the last period of the Paleozoic Era (_see_ p. 3).
